Seven hard-won months into her sobriety, sociology professor Maris Heilman has her first blackout. She chalks it up to exhaustion, though she fears that her husband and daughter will suspect she’s drinking again. Whatever their cause, the glitches start becoming more frequent. Sometimes minutes, sometimes longer, but always leaving Maris with the same disorienting question: Where have I been?

Then another blackout lands Maris in the ER, where she makes an alarming discovery. A network of women is battling the same inexplicable malady. Is it a bizarre coincidence or something more sinister? What do all the women have in common besides missing time? Or is it who they have in common?

In a desperate search for answers, Maris has no idea what’s coming next—just the escalating paranoia that her memories may be beyond her control, and that everything she knows could disappear in the blink of an eye.

Erin Flanagan is the Edgar Award–nominated author of Deer Season and two short story collections, The Usual Mistakes and It’s Not Going to Kill You and Other Stories. She’s held fellowships to Yaddo, MacDowell, the Sewanee Writers’ Conference, the Bread Loaf Writers’ Conference, Ucross, and the Vermont Studio Center. An English professor at Wright State University, Erin lives in Dayton, Ohio, with her husband, daughter, two cats, two dogs, and her friendly, caustic thoughts. C “This book is divided into six parts, with 46 chapters, and a total of about 294 pages, not including the Acknowledgments.

The main character is Dr. Maris Heilman, a college professor at Glenn State in Dayton, Ohio. Maris lives with her husband Noel, and her teenage daughter Cody. Most of the story is told from the third person perspective as Maris experiences the events; but there are a few chapters that are told from the first person perspective of a mysterious unnamed woman.

The book starts off with an intriguing hook right away in Chapter One: As we follow Maris through a regular evening at her house, the text actually cuts out mid-sentence to indicate a blackout:

“and took a
her hands rubbing circles over her cheeks as if the world had gone form complete black to light…”

The author uses this effect several times to powerfully demonstrate the blackouts that Maris is suffering from. The narration will be in the middle of a sentence and then cut out, leave a break of three dashes, then resume in a completely different context. I thought that this was a really clever touch, as it gives the reader a jarring experience that mimics what Maris must be feeling. The stress for Maris is only made worse by the fact that she is a recovering alcoholic, and she worries that everyone else will think her blackouts are caused by her starting to drink again. Unfortunately, as much as I liked the text-blackout gimmick, I found the rest of the book to be pretty disappointing.

As the story progresses, the plot seems to get less and less believable, and by the end I was regretting that I had spent so much time reading this book. With such a clever hook and blackout mystery, I had hoped for an equally clever and twisty plot, or brilliant use of characters, or a fantastic ending…. but I finished the book and felt some combination of cringe and disappointment. There are themes that this book leans into VERY hard, and by the end it just felt almost like a caricature of real issues.

Overall I guess I’d give this book a 3/5. I have to give some credit for the way the author conveyed the confusion of blackouts and lost time, and I was curious enough to keep reading. I personally didn’t really enjoy the rest of the plot or the ending though, and I thought the overall message was a bit heavy-handed. This was definitely not one of my favorite First Reads, but everyone has their own preferences, and you might feel differently.”
